LI U 3x Braindrain PU U 2x Call the Cops PU U 1x Double Team PU U 3x Fly Away PU R 3x Practical Joke PU U 1x Read the Riot Act PU U 3x Scientfic Solution PU U 1x Stay Out of Reach PU C ----------- Deck Notes: Strategy: This deck has many missions in it because it is a fast deck. This deck may have some trouble in the first 1-5 turns, because you can hardly attempt any missions and stuff. But, then the deck kicks in about the 7th turn. Start attempting as many missions you can, and always use the ones that give you the higher strength first, because again, this is a speedy deck. The villians that will be easiest for you to eliminate are Brood and Toad. When using Teamwork, use with Professor X-It'll give you 10 Power! When using Braindrain, retrieve cards like Natural Disaster. Call The Cops can be useful when villian's mutant powers get on your nerves.
